Had a really bad chalazion. Doctors refused to help me. by Strict_Debate3923 in Blepharitis

[–]TheDingles 5 points6 points  (0 children)

Many doctors do not know much about chalazions. Everyone I saw was pretty much useless until I visited a specific ophthalmologist where I had lived at the time of my issues. We would discuss solutions at length, and I could tell he respected my input. He knew I had done my research. Everyone needs a doctor like that.

Clinics often prescribe antibiotic eye drops, which are not effective. The only antibiotic I know of that is effective for chalazions is doxycycline.

Your bad experience aside, you were pretty lucky this thing drained. A lot of the time, they just harden and become a cyst that may never go away. Only surgery takes care of them. I recommend continuing hot compresses and massaging the lid to continue to completely drain it.

Tankbuster om Shiv’s knives? by Mewtwothis in DeadlockTheGame

[–]TheDingles 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Tankbuster simply adds more damage to any ability that deals at least the amount of damage listed on the item. It's meant for burst and would work on Shiv's 2 if you have enough spirit to hit that amount of damage.

Now, if you stacked enough knives, or had a lot of spirit, to the point where a tick of knife damage hits the item's threshold, then sure, I don't see any reason why it wouldn't proc. Keep in mind though, Tankbuster has a cooldown, so not every tick would proc the item.

Doc put me on a six week course of Doxycycline? by Objective-Pen7633 in Blepharitis

[–]TheDingles 2 points3 points  (0 children)

Doxycycline will in fact help your eyelids. Probably dramatically. I personally think that dose is way too high, and that positive effects can come from a low dose, but doxycycline is a proven way to alleviate blepharitis.

Will it get rid of the problem forever? Absolutely not. This is a lifelong condition for most that requires maintenance above all else for relief. A low dose of doxy can definitely be very beneficial short term though, followed up by other means of fixing it longer term.

[deleted by user] by [deleted] in Blepharitis

[–]TheDingles 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Fortunately, it is most likely NOT a stye or chalazion forming if there is no pain. Chalazions are very annoying to deal with, and will have a stinging, stabbing like pain in the eyelid.

This could be blepharitis due environmental changes (new pillow) or allergies. It will most likely settle down on its own. I would use a warm compress and gently massage the eyelid to keep the meibomian gland oils moving.

If you start to feel stinging pain, that could be an infection/blocked gland happening.
